The new Volkswagen Amarok will be coming to Australia in early 2011. But to give you a glimpse into its class-leading features, we've updated the Amarok Record Lab with a few extras.
Earlier this year, the new Amarok was the Official Car of the 2010 Dakar Rally Organisation (and we'll be back again in 2011). Roughing it through Argentina and Chile, the Dakar is the world's most grueling rally where only the toughest off-road vehicles prosper. Amongst these heavy hitters, Amarok stood proud, backing up the successful 1-2-3 win for the Volkswagen Motorsport team. Dislikes
-Tactile quality of the dash wasn't upto VW Passenger division but was way better than some cars available today didn't feel cheap just not upto VW Passenger division standards.
-Straps that hold up rear seat look and feel like an afterthought and my bet won't last long if used alot.
-Front seat height adjuster also was flimsy the shape and length feels like it could break.
-Fold down rear seat (I didn't do) as it a two person job one person each end must lift the strap to fold seat down.
-Tailgate shut I thought I could see through the gap to the tray on the white one & brown one no gap ?????? (Comp = Holden no gap, Toyota gap, Nissan gap, new Ford no gap & Isuzu gap)
Likes
-Overall quality was great Felt like a big Golf which is what I felt & heard lots of people saying.
-Clutch feels nice and easy like a Golf or T5.
-Rear seat was so comfortable with Leather
